Transaction 8050340ef4e248a603f47f731ce99985176fdcb1401401d65b6f2028cb4d7329

4 Input
2 Outputs
  • 8050340ef4e248a603f47f731ce99985176fdcb1401401d65b6f2028cb4d7329:0
  • value  95079580
    address  16BTWLRxVrWys8SNX7ZLntwSGGBHsGHyzV
  • 8050340ef4e248a603f47f731ce99985176fdcb1401401d65b6f2028cb4d7329:1
  • value  1000020
    address  1BQWRHJzFEw1T6x9TayTfJBbncgRKJi6FT